Transaction 10c1171ef816cbc116aee652e4b8c97c4c5ef90ab713226f124d1e3597edc04d

56 Input
2 Outputs
  • 10c1171ef816cbc116aee652e4b8c97c4c5ef90ab713226f124d1e3597edc04d:0
  • value  1159652386
    address  1C85ZpmLPLfc9r11NAmcWPsJWyDTQmzF9x
  • 10c1171ef816cbc116aee652e4b8c97c4c5ef90ab713226f124d1e3597edc04d:1
  • value  954188
    address  1NLgnuji7MR5ow46nwBvmJWBiwFTR1H4FB